When and How to Change Your Vape Coil: Everything You Need to Know

With the exception of your e-liquid, your vape coil is the part of your vape that you will need to change out most often. Proper vape coil maintenance keeps your e-liquid tasting great and prevents your coil from causing damage to your vape.

Coils are housed within your vape tank and contain a wick made of a material like cotton. The wicks are what your e-liquid soaks into and when your vape heats up, this e-liquid turns into vapour.

Vape Coil Versus Atomiser

There’s a lot of terminology in vaping and sometimes words are used interchangeably, like vape coils and atomisers. Atomisers are what turn your e-liquid into vapour and they usually hold your e-liquid and coil inside them. However, sometimes coils are listed as atomisers so it can be a bit confusing if you are trying to replace your coil. 

Most coils slide right out of your tank so removing and replacing them is as easy as taking one out and popping another one in. 

Vape Coil Longevity

How often you change out your coil will depend on different factors, but most people find they have to change it every week or two. If your vapour tastes bad, however, you most likely have a burned-out coil that needs to be replaced.

If the bad taste happens right after you get a new coil, you may not have let the e-liquid saturate the wicking long enough. Chain vaping can prematurely burn out your coil too, so wait at least 20 seconds between puffs. 

Other Signs Your Coil Needs to be Replaced

  • Low vapour production even when the battery is charged
  • Gurgling sounds or popping sounds
  • E-liquid that tastes odd or weak

When you change out your coil, it is important to prime it first. Put a few drops of e-liquid into the holes of your atomiser and leave it for a few minutes to soak into the wick. Once you put the coil into your atomiser and fill the tank with liquid, let your vape sit for a further few minutes. The longer you let the e-liquid soak into the coil, the less likely you are to burn out your coil.
